Marry Me a Little is a revue created entirely of songs cut from Sondheim shows. It was conceived and developed by Craig Lucas and Norman Rene. Set in a Manhattan apartment building it employs 2 characters a man and a woman who live in the same building but never meet. Marry Me opened March 12, 1981 at the Actor's Playhouse and it closed on May 31, 1981. It ran for 96 performances after a brief off- off Broadway run at The Production Company. Music and Lyrics by Stephen Sondheim, Produced by Diane de Mailly in association with William B. Young , Directed by Norman Rene , Musical Direction by E. Martin Perry, Choreography by Don Johanson , Setting by Jane Thurin, Lighting by Debra J. Kletter ,Costumes by Oleksa.

Cast: Craig Lucas and Suzanne Henry

Musical Numbers:

"Saturday Night" -from Saturday Night
"Two Fairy Tales" -cut from A Little Night Music
"Can That Boy Foxtrot!" -cut from Follies
"All Things Bright and Beautiful" -cut from Follies
"Bang!" cut from A Little Night Music
"All Things Bright and Beautiful (Part 2)" -cut from Follies
"The Girls of Summer" -from The Girls of Summer
"Uptown, Downtown" -cut from Follies
"So Many People" -from Saturday Night
"Your Eyes Are Blue" -cut from A Funny Thing Happened...
A Moment With You" -from Saturday Night
"Marry Me A Little" -cut from Company
"Happily Ever After" -cut from Company
"Pour Le Sport" -from The Last Resorts, unproduced
"Silly People" -cut from A Little Night Music
"There Won't Be Trumpets" -cut from Anyone Can Whistle
"It Wasn't Meant to Happen" -cut from Follies
"Who Could Be Blue?" -cut from Follies
"Little White House" -cut from Follies
